The Indoor Air Problem Most Homeowners Overlook

You cannot always see what is in the air around you. Ultrafine particles, mold spores, and chemical compounds are invisible to the naked eye, yet they circulate through your home every day. In a coastal environment like the Outer Banks, humidity can make conditions more favorable for mold and bacterial growth, which means the air inside your home may contain more airborne contaminants than you realize.

Common indoor air concerns include:

  • Dust and dust mites
  • Pet dander and allergens
  • Mold and mildew spores
  • Bacteria and viruses
  • Volatile organic compounds from cleaning products and furniture
  • Odors from cooking, pets, and daily living
  • Ultrafine particles from outside pollutants

For families with children, older adults, or anyone sensitive to allergies or respiratory issues, these contaminants can affect comfort, sleep, and overall wellbeing.

Why Outer Banks Homes Benefit From Advanced Air Purification

The Outer Banks is a beautiful place to live, but the coastal environment creates unique air quality challenges. Salt air, moisture, and humidity levels can all contribute to conditions that accelerate mold growth and allow airborne particles to linger longer indoors.

Seasonal rental properties and year-round residences alike can benefit from advanced filtration for these reasons:

  • High humidity encourages mold growth, which releases spores into the air
  • Salt air can carry fine particles that find their way indoors
  • Older homes may have limited air circulation, allowing pollutants to build up over time
  • Vacationers and guests bring in allergens and contaminants from outside
  • Pets, cooking, and cleaning products all contribute to indoor air quality issues

Odor Reduction That Actually Works

Gas and odor adsorption is one of the most noticeable benefits of advanced air filtration. Unlike air fresheners that simply cover odors with fragrance, advanced filtration systems actively neutralize the compounds responsible for smells.

That means:

  • Cooking odors do not linger through the house
  • Pet smells stay under control
  • Musty or mildew scents from coastal humidity are reduced
  • Chemical odors from cleaning products clear out faster

Your home smells cleaner because the air actually is cleaner.
